How is Maintenance and repair of structures defined in a legal contract?

  • Maintenance and repair of structures means The activities such as interior remodeling, painting, decorating, paneling, plumbing, insulation, replacement of windows and doors, fixing electric circuitry, and siding. This also includes shingles and sheathing work, and other activities involving the nonstructural elements of a building, the process of repairing cracks found in foundations, sidewalks, walkways, and the process of waterproofing the foundations.
